My weekly analysis is the concert that we had at Nationwide Arena this week featuring Elton John and Billy Joel. This is when you love going to worl. The atmosphere there at the arena was electrifying. these are two of the greatest music icons in the world, on stage together. They opened up together singing, " Dont Let the Sun Go Down on Me", the crowd was just screaming. It actually gave me chills. After that Elton John performed first, and then Billy Joel. The staging was so great, even the people in the press level ( nosebleed section) had a perfect view of the stage/ The backdrop was a black see thru glittering material, so the view qas great for all those ticket holders. I actually feel their view was as good as some of the higher priced seats, which ranged from as high as $225.00 on the floor level.
One of the best highlights of my evening was I was able to take one of my group members on the floor and she got to see Elton John up close. She was so close that she was able to see the sweat drip off of hima dn she started to cry. She was so happy and thankful, she kept saying thank you over and over again. I don't think I realized how star struck I was when I was down there. I have seen a lot of concerts their and this one was one of the greatest. I thought Faith Hill and Tim McGraw was the best, but this one came awful close. They both came back out together and concluded the concert with the all time favorite "Bennie and the Jets".
